Output 3a95399623b75915f39b2521f3e27ca988f1219f98848ca5b92a0a7e1fe2ac93:28

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bdef704338dca3494fcc341d959f601ed2cb503bd6ef9e560cb836d79f6b41c
address
bc1pm000wppn3h9rf98ucdqajk0kq8kjedgrh4h0netqewpk670kkswqqcya0v
transaction
3a95399623b75915f39b2521f3e27ca988f1219f98848ca5b92a0a7e1fe2ac93
spent
true